Mercedes-Benz A-Class Limousine vs BMW 2 Series Gran Coupe: Price Comparison

- The Mercedes-Benz A-Class Limousine is the new entry-level luxury model.
- It replaces the Mercedes-Benz CLA in the German carmaker's India line-up.
- The Mercedes-Benz A-Class Limousine competes with the BMW 2 Series GC.
The Mercedes-Benz A-Class Limousine is finally on sale in India and will sold in three iterations- the A 200 petrol, the A 200d diesel and the range-topping Mercedes-AMG A35 which is the performance oriented version of the entry-level luxury sedan. Now the Mercedes-Benz A-Class Limousine actually replaces the CLA in the German carmaker's India line-up and is more practical and comfortable. That said, in India it currently lock horns with just one model- the BMW 2 Series Gran Coupe as its other counterparts such as Audi is yet to bring in its entry-level luxury model- the new-generation Audi A3. Here's how the new Mercedes-Benz A-Class Limousine fares against the BMW 2 Series Gran Coupe in terms of pricing.

The Mercedes-Benz A-Class Limousine rivals the likes of the BMW 2 Series Gran Coupe.
| Variants | Mercedes-Benz A-Class Limo | BMW 2 Series Gran Coupe |
|---|---|---|
| Petrol | Rs. 39.90 lakh | Rs. 37.90 lakh - Rs. 40.90 lakh |
| Diesel | Rs. 40.90 lakh | Rs. 40.40 lakh - Rs. 42.30 lakh |
| Performance | Rs. 56.24 lakh | N.A. |

(BMW recently launched the 220i Sport, which is a base variant of the 2 GC. It skimps on a few features like a larger infotainment display, digital console, gesture control, but packs in all the essential features)
Mercedes-Benz India launched the A-Class Limousine in just one variant for the petrol, diesel and the AMG and it is packed to the gills with features. It is however, Rs. 2 lakh more expensive than the base variant of the 2 GC, but Rs. 1 lakh more affordable on the top trim for the petrol variant.

The Mercedes-AMG A35 sedan will also be locally assembled in India.
The Mercedes-Benz A-Class Limousine A 200d diesel is Rs.50,000 more expensive than the base trim of the BMW 2 Series Gran Coupe 220d diesel, but the top-end trim of the latter is more expensive by Rs. 1.4 lakh. Now there is also the Mercedes-AMG A35 performance sedan in the range which actually doesn't have any direct rival in India. That said, BMW does offer an entry-level performance sedan in India- the BMW M340i which outperforms the A-Class Limo performance wise, and at Rs. 62.90 lakh is more expensive.
